#edb97f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#edb97f is composed of 92.9% red, 72.5%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.9% magenta, 46.4%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 31.6 degrees, a saturation of 75.3% and a lightness of 71.4%. #edb97f color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ffe with #db7300.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#edb97f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#edb97f has RGB values of R:237, G:185, B:127 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.46,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15579519.

Shades and Tints of #edb97f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0601 is the darkest color, while #fefbf7 is the lightest one.
